码迷,mamicode.com
首页 >  
搜索关键字:copy-on-write    ( 136个结果
CopyOnWriteArrayList源码add加锁的意义
源码 网上看到的解释 网上关于CopyOnWriteArrayList的文章大多拷贝自http://ifeve.com/java-copy-on-write/ ,原文对这个疑问的解释如下: 我的理解 这里我觉得这原文的解释不太合理,我的思考是:add的流程“是复制当前数组获得新数组 -> 将元素放到 ...
分类:其他好文   时间:2019-07-06 17:39:41    阅读次数:80
qemu使用copy-on-write(COW)磁盘
写时复制(copy-on-write,缩写COW)技术不会对原始的镜像文件做更改,变化的部分写在另外的镜像文件中,这种特性在qemu中只有QCOW格式支持,多个 COW 文件可以指向同一映像同时测试多个配置, 而不会危及基本系统。 下面以windows2003为例介绍使用过程,首先安装windows ...
分类:其他好文   时间:2019-05-04 11:56:48    阅读次数:114
MIT-JOS系列:用户态访问页表项详解
在MIT JOS lab4的实验中,为了能够在用户态自定义处理页面错误,我们必须要知道操作的页面的属性(是否当前用户具有读写权限、是否copy on write页面),这就需要查询指向当前物理页面的页表项和目录表项获取它的属性 在之前的实验中,我们已经通过 修改 的目录表项,用此操作允许用户读取任一 ...
分类:其他好文   时间:2019-04-18 18:32:44    阅读次数:183
redis面试题
1.什么是redis? Redis本质是一个Key_Value类型的内存数据库,整个数据库系统加载在内存当中进行操作, 定期通过异步操作把数据库数据使用Copy_on_write技术持久化到硬盘中保存。 2.redis的优点: 支持多种数据结构,单个value的最大限制是1GB 每秒超过10万次的读 ...
分类:其他好文   时间:2019-04-07 09:42:38    阅读次数:154
docker存储
一、docker 存储 1. storage driver 容器由最上面一个可写的容器层,以及若 干只读的镜像层组成,容器的数据就存放 在这些层中。这样的分层结构最大的特性 是 Copy-on-Write: 1.新数据会直接存放在最上面的容器层。 2.修改现有数据会先从镜像层将数据复制 到容器层,修 ...
分类:其他好文   时间:2019-04-03 22:01:51    阅读次数:188
003 CopyOnWriteArrayList原理
聊聊并发-Java中的Copy-On-Write容器 Copy-On-Write简称COW,是一种用于程序设计中的优化策略。其基本思路是,从一开始大家都在共享同一个内容,当某个人想要修改这个内容的时候,才会真正把内容Copy出去形成一个新的内容然后再改,这是一种延时懒惰策略。从JDK1.5开始Jav ...
分类:其他好文   时间:2019-02-19 00:53:09    阅读次数:166
使用引用计数和copy-on_write实现String类
本文写于2017 01 18,从老账号迁移到本账号,原文地址:https://www.cnblogs.com/huangweiyang/p/6295420.html 这算是我开始复习的内容吧,关于string类半年前写过,最近拿出来溜溜,以免面试被问到结果自己忘了。我之前的博客地址: "C++引用计 ...
分类:其他好文   时间:2019-02-06 09:18:07    阅读次数:188
APUE第八章-进程控制
一、进程标识 二、函数fork 1.写时复制,copy-on-write 2.文件共享,父进程等待子进程完成,子进程结束后,它对任一共享描述符的读写操作的文件偏移量已做相应的更新,同时操作时,可以考虑使用文件锁 三、函数vfork 1.不完全复制父进程的地址空间 2.保证子进程先运行,直到其调用ex ...
分类:系统相关   时间:2019-01-19 12:15:17    阅读次数:253
任督二脉之进程管理(2)
一、第二次课大纲1.fork、vfork、clone2.写时拷贝技术3.Linux线程的实现本质4.进程0和进程15.进程的睡眠和等待队列6.孤儿进程的托孤,SUBREAPER1.fork、vfork、Copy-on-Write例子2.life-period例子,实验体会托孤3.pthread_cr ...
分类:系统相关   时间:2019-01-18 17:28:21    阅读次数:277
CopyOnWriteArrayList你都不知道,怎么拿offer?
前言 只有光头才能变强 前一阵子写过一篇COW(Copy On Write)文章,结果阅读量很低啊...COW奶牛!Copy On Write机制了解一下 可能大家对这个技术比较陌生吧,但这项技术是挺多应用场景的。除了上文所说的Linux、文件系统外,其实在Java也有其身影。 大家对线程安全容器可 ...
分类:其他好文   时间:2018-12-11 14:36:13    阅读次数:188
136条   上一页 1 2 3 4 ... 14 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!